1. Cherry Vodka Cocktail.

Image Source: videojug.com

Pour the cherry vodka, lime vodka and orange juice into a cocktail shaker half-filled with ice cubes. Shake well until it blends perfectly and tadaaa!! Your Cherry Vodka Cocktail is ready now strain it into a cocktail glass. Garnish with a maraschino cherry, and serve.

3. Lemon Vodka Slush

Image Source: dailytri.wordpress.com

Blend sugar, and lime peel in the boiling water, until the sugar, dissolve perfectly. Now add the lime juice, lemon Vodka and ice cubes and blend it on high speed in a blender until it becomes slushy. Leave it for 15 seconds and then you can taste the lemony-lemony Lemon Vodka Slush.

4. Vampire Dream

Image Source: alfa-img.com

Well, all you have to do is pour your favorite Rum, pineapple juice, cranberry juice and grenadine in a cocktail shaker. Fill it with ice and shake it vigorously and it’s done. Now serve it with some more ice cubes.

6. Bramble

Image Source: ginfoundry.com

Well, this one is our favourite, you have to combine blackberries and the lemon juice into a rocks glass and muddle it until the berries are open up. Then you have to add some crushed ice and gin. Stir it till it blends completely and serve it.
